[DigitalToday reporter Chi-gyu Hwang (황치규)] Google said on July 31 it had unveiled Gemini Robotics 2, a core intelligence model for next-generation robots.
The company said Gemini Robotics 2 enables robots to plan and carry out all movements intelligently, perform a range of tasks and work with other robots to complete jobs.
The company also stressed that this physical intelligence can run locally on devices and adapt to new robot forms within hours.
These features are implemented through three models: Gemini Robotics 2, Gemini Robotics ER 2 and Gemini Robotics On-Device 2.
Gemini Robotics 2 is Google’s vision-language-action model. It can control both humanoid full-body robots from toe to fingertip and two-armed bimanual robots.
Gemini Robotics ER 2 is a vision-language model that performs Google’s embodied reasoning and agent roles. It supports robots in communicating with people, understanding physical environments and planning multi-step tasks that last for minutes.
Gemini Robotics On-Device 2 is a vision-language-action model optimised to run locally on robot devices. It enables rapid adaptation to entirely new robot forms with only a few hours of data.
